The LIFE SILENT and RE-PLAN CITY LIFE Projects Workshop was a two-day event in Rome designed to showcase the latest innovations and best practices in using Recycled Tyre Materials (RTMs) for creating low-noise, sustainable pavements. On the first day, participants embarked on a technical visit to a rubberised asphalt plant, gaining firsthand insights into the production process.
On the second day, attendees explored cutting-edge research and technical advancements during an international seminar and engaged in a roundtable discussion with experts and stakeholders. These sessions aimed to address challenges and develop strategies for integrating sustainable materials into road construction.
The workshop provided an opportunity to understand the benefits and challenges of rubberised asphalt in transport infrastructure, promote green procurement with Public Administrations, and collaborate on projects aligned with circular economy principles. It also served as a platform to network with European experts, policymakers, and stakeholders committed to sustainability.
